What is Mauritanian Ouguiya
The Mauritanian Ouguiya is the official currency of Mauritania, a country located in North West Africa. It is denoted by the symbol "UM" and is used in everyday economic transactions within the nation. This fiat currency plays a central role in the Mauritanian economy and is managed by the Central Bank of Mauritania, which oversees monetary policy, including the issuance and circulation of the Ouguiya.
The Mauritanian Ouguiya is unique amongst world currencies as it is not based on a decimal system. Instead, it operates on a base five system, where one Ouguiya is subdivided into five khoums. This distinct setup sets it apart from most other global currencies that follow a decimal structure, typically with 100 smaller units making up the main unit of currency.
In terms of physical form, the Mauritanian Ouguiya is available in both coin and banknote formats. Coins are available in denominations of 1/5, 1, 5, 10, and 20 Ouguiya, while banknotes come in denominations of 50, 100, 200, 500, 1,000, and 5,000 Ouguiya. The design and imagery featured on the currency often reflect the nation's cultural heritage and historical landmarks.
The Ouguiya plays a pivotal role in the economic activities within Mauritania, facilitating all forms of transactions, from the most basic daily purchases to larger business dealings. Like all currencies, its value can fluctuate based on a variety of factors, including economic stability, inflation, and external market forces.
While the Mauritanian Ouguiya is primarily used within Mauritania, it's important to note that it may not be easily convertible or accepted outside the country. Therefore, travelers or those conducting business internationally may need to consider currency exchange rates and availability. As with any currency, the Mauritanian Ouguiya's value and stability are inherently tied to the economic health and governance of the nation.

What Influences the NWS to MRU Exchange Rate?
The exchange rate between Nodewaves (NWS) and Mauritanian Ouguiya (MRU) is influenced by a range of global and local factors. If you are interested to trade or invest in NWS, understanding what drives this conversion can help you make more informed decisions.
1. Market Sentiment and News
Crypto markets are highly reactive to sentiment. Positive developments, such as major partnerships, increased adoption, or favorable media coverage-can drive up demand and increase the NWS to MRU rate. On the flip side, negative press, security issues, or regulatory actions may result in price drops.
2. Government Regulation and Legal Clarity
The regulatory environment in both the cryptocurrency's key markets and MRU-issuing countries plays a major role. Supportive policies can increase confidence and adoption, pushing rates higher. On the other hand, restrictive or unclear regulations often introduce market uncertainty.
3. MRU Currency Strength and Local Economic Indicators
Traditional economic factors like interest rates, inflation, and GDP performance directly influence MRU's strength. When MRU weakens due to inflation or policy changes, investors may seek alternatives like NWS, increasing demand and raising the exchange rate.
4. Blockchain and Technology Developments
For cryptocurrencies like Nodewaves, improvements in technology such as network upgrades, scalability solutions, or ecosystem expansion-often lead to increased adoption and price growth. These changes can enhance investor confidence and influence exchange rates positively.
5. Global Financial Events and Market Trends
Macroeconomic trends such as global inflation fears, geopolitical tensions, or changes in interest rates by central banks can prompt a shift toward digital assets as a store of value. In uncertain times, demand for NWS may rise, impacting its conversion to MRU.
